This is the first major restructuring of the executive since his election in 2019. Javier Remírez will assume the position of first vice president of the government of Navarra

The president of Navarre, María Chivite, has announced a remodelling of her government a year and a half after the end of the legislature and in the midst of the crisis unleashed by the 'Cerdan case'. The head of the executive dismisses one of her strong men, the first vice president, Félix Taberna, and Amparo López, the until now face and voice of the executive in the sessions of government and responsible for the macrocartera of Interior, Publ…

Senator Javier Remírez will be the first vice president of the Government of Navarra, spokesman and adviser of Presidency and Equality, and the former parliamentarian Inma Jurío, responsible for Interior, Justice and Public Service. Read more]]>
